Ghemme 2005 is a vintage wine that follows and highlights what was announced in 2004: important structure and aromas that evolve and grow continuously. 

On the nose, it has spicy hints supported by a slight vanilla that does not dominate the aromas of Nebbiolo.

In the mouth pervades a sense of balance as only a Nebbiolo of Alto Piemonte can express.

The year 2005 won several awards: 2 Gambero Rosso glasses, l'Espresso - Vini d'Italia 3 Bottiglie, Guida Oro - Veronelli 2 stelle rosse, Touring Club 3 stelle rosse

Weight: 750ml

Grape variety: 90% Nebbiolo 10% Vespolina.

Alc. %: 13,5

Production area: D.O.C.G. territory of Ghemme. Minimal use of chemical agents.

Method of breeding: guyot.

Harvest: manual in boxes.

Vinification: in stainless steel tanks with temperature control, followed by malolactic fermentation.

Ageing: at least 3 years in medium-sized French Allier oak barrels.

Aging: at least 6 months in bottle.

Serving temperature: serve at 16-17 ºC, in a large glass, taking care to ventilate well before tasting.

Recommended pairings: excellent with red meat, braised meats, game and mature cheeses.

Company name: Az. Agr. Torraccia del Piantavigna SRL
